Kayak Fishing - Fishing for Food Using Mixed Methods

If you enjoy eating fish and shellfish there is something special about sitting down to the dinner table to have a meal from something you have caught yourself.

 

In the video below, I set out to catch fish for the dinner table using mixed methods to catch a variety of fish such as Plaice, Mackerel, Herring Pollack, and Spider Crabs using collapsible pots.
